    Gotta say up until now I have enjoyed anything written by Janet Evanovich. The Big Kahuna is a rare exception. I did not realize Lee Goldberg was not part of the writing team on this book. His presence and voice are sorely missed. The whole fun of these books comes from the weird and wacky crew Nick pulls together and the cons he plans for the bad guys! I love it when Nick and Kate win. I love Kate’s father and the “old guys network” he calls in to play a part with whatever the current caper is. I had to make myself continue to read this book and I must admit it was a struggle. I was b.o.r.e.d! The first 3/4 of the book reads like a travel brochure. Not fun at all. I gave 2 stars because there really was some action (finally!) but it didn’t come along until the final few chapters. Overall an extremely disappointing installment of the Fox and O’Hare series.
